What are Manager OpenEdge Progress jobs?

Manager OpenEdge Progress jobs typically involve overseeing teams that develop, maintain, and optimize applications using Progress OpenEdge technologies. These managers coordinate projects, ensure the quality and performance of OpenEdge-based systems, and facilitate communication between technical staff and business stakeholders. They are also responsible for resource planning, budget management, and aligning the team’s work with organizational goals. Strong leadership, technical expertise in OpenEdge, and project management skills are essential for success in this role.

What are some common challenges faced by Managers working with OpenEdge Progress environments, and how can they be addressed?

Managers overseeing OpenEdge Progress environments often encounter challenges such as integrating legacy systems with modern applications, ensuring database performance, and managing a mix of in-house and external development teams. Addressing these issues typically involves staying up-to-date with the latest OpenEdge releases, implementing best practices for system monitoring and optimization, and fostering strong communication between team members. Proactively investing in staff training and leveraging vendor support can also help resolve technical hurdles more efficiently.

Service Wire Company, a premier supplier of industrial and utility wire and cable, is currently seeking a Senior Software Engineer in Culloden, WV. If you are looking to join a great organization and a chance to become a part of our growing team, this may be the opportunity for you!
 
Position Summary:
As a Senior Software Engineer you will play a pivotal role in developing, enhancing, and maintaining our QAD ERP system. Your expertise in Progress 4GL/OpenEdge programming will be instrumental in optimizing our ERP processes, ensuring seamless integration with other systems, and contributing to the overall efficiency and effectiveness of our IT operations.
Tasks/Duties/Responsibilities:

Advanced ERP System Development

  • Develop complex Progress 4GL/OpenEdge applications, focusing on scalability and optimization for the QAD ERP environment.
  • Lead the design and implementation of new features, modules, and customizations in the ERP system to meet evolving business needs.

Database Management

  • Understand concepts and functionality around database design, tuning, and troubleshooting for Progress databases linked to the ERP system.
  • Implement robust data backup and recovery procedures, ensuring data security and compliance.

System Integration and API Development

  • Lead and/or support initiatives to integrate the QAD ERP with various internal and external systems, ensuring seamless data flow and functionality.
  • Develop, test, and maintain APIs for efficient data exchange and system integration.

Strategic Collaboration and User Support 

  • Collaborate with key stakeholders to understand department-specific requirements and translate these into technical solutions.
  • Provide mentorship and training to junior developers and end-users, enhancing overall team capability and ERP system utilization.

Continuous System Improvement and Innovation

  • Proactively identify opportunities for system enhancements, conducting research and proposing innovative solutions.
  • Stay abreast of the latest trends in Progress programming, ERP technology, and manufacturing industry best practices.
Knowledge/Skills/Abilities:
  • Bachelor’s or Master’s Deg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or a related field
  • Minimum of 5 years of experience in Progress 4GL/OpenEdge programming, with a strong preference for experience in a manufacturing environment
  • Deep understanding of QAD ERP systems, including EE, Adaptive, advanced modules and customization capabilities
  • Expertise in managing and optimizing Progress databases, with a focus on performance tuning and security
  • Advanced knowledge of QAD’s .Net UI, Qxtend integration, and eB2.0 framework preferred
  • Proficiency in Linux/Unix environments and familiarity with cloud-based ERP solutions preferred
  • Experience with additional programming languages (e.g., Java, SQL) and modern software development methodologies (e.g., Agile, Scrum) preferred
  • Experience in a manufacturing environment preferred
  • Ability to adapt to changing priorities and deadlines
  • Strong project management skills and the ability to lead cross-functional teams.
  • Excellent communication skills, both written and verbal, with the ability to explain complex technical concepts to non-technical stakeholders.
